diff --git a/src/main.zig b/src/main.zig index 6e7a6526..a1dd2a67 100644 --- a/src/main.zig +++ b/src/main.zig @@ -52,7 +52,7 @@ pub fn main() !void { const alloc = if (builtin.mode == .Debug) gpa.allocator() else std.heap.c_allocator; defer if (builtin.mode == .Debug) { - _ = gpa.detectLeaks(); + if (gpa.detectLeaks()) std.posix.exit(1); }; var args_arena = std.heap.ArenaAllocator.init(alloc);